基于环境因子AI-GIS方法的天然滑坡危险性预测--以香港大屿山岛为例

摘    要:利用人工神经元网络(AI)及地理信息系统(GIS)技术,将多元空间信息分析与非线性理论相结合,建立了基于环境因子的区域滑坡非线性预测模型.选择天然滑坡比较发育的香港大屿山岛中部作为试验研究区,定量分析了滑坡与各种环境因子的空间关系,进行了因子筛选,据此对区域天然滑坡进行了危险性分区.结果表明,该方法可获取较高的预测精度,是完全可行的.该方法的应用将为区域滑坡危险性区划及滑坡灾害的防治提供重要依据.

关 键 词:人工神经元网络  地理信息系统  环境因子  区域滑坡预测

PREDICTION OF REGIONAL LANDSLIDE DANGER AREAS USING AI-GIS BASED ON ENVIRONMENT FACTORS:AN EXAMPLE OF LANTAU ISLAND,HONGKONG

Abstract:By adopting artificial intelligence(AI) and GIS and multi-spatial information spacial analysis method and non-linear prediction method,the non-linear prediction model is set up on the basis of environmental factors.The middle part of Lantau Island in Hongkong is selected as an experimental study area,for the analysis of the relationship between landslides and environmental factors which are filtered. Hence, the first prediction map of regional landslide evaluation in the middle part of Lantau Island is obtained. The results show that AI-GIS model has a most precision, and obviously is better than other methods. The method will offer important scientific basis for studying the regional landslide danger areas and landslide disasteres.
Keywords:artificial intelligence(AI)  GIS  environmental factor  prediction of regional landslide
